Law student drops domestic violence allegation against Antony

One of the three women who have made claims of domestic violence against Manchester United star Antony has dropped her case.

Antony was first accused of assaulting former girlfriend Gabriela Cavallin, who alleged that the Brazilian attacked her on several occasions between June 2022 and May 2023.

Cavallin had also claimed that she required hospital treatment from the alleged assault. She also accused Antony of dislodging one of her breast implants by punching her in the chest, requiring her to undergo surgery.

Few days later, two other women came forward with claims against Antony, including law student Rayssa de Freitas, who alleged to have been injured by Antony following an assault in a car.

Rayssa de Freitas had claimed that she needed hospital treatment after being attacked by Antony and an internet personality Mallu Ohana in the backseat of Antony’s Land Rover after a night out in the Brazilian city of Sao Paulo. The case has been dropped at the request of the law student.

The Telegraph has now reported that De Freitas has withdrawn the allegation against Antony, and a police report from the time has also been retracted in full.

Antony has continued to strenuously deny all the domestic violence allegations against him, and he remains on indefinite paid leave from Man United while he contests the accusations.

The Brazil international who left Sao Paulo for Ajax in 2020, has scored eight goals and provided three assists in 48 games for the Red Devils since his big-money move to Old Trafford.

Antony’s absence coincides with Jadon Sancho’s exile from the first team, as the England international has been ostracised by Erik ten Hag after publicly calling out the manager’s claims over his effort in training.
